The Lone Bellow photo

The Lone Bellow setlist en Royal Concert Hall en Glasgow, United Kingdom el 25 de enero de 2020

The Lone Bellow setlist en 25 de enero de 2020 en Royal Concert Hall en Glasgow, United Kingdom